Video Wall Market Size, Share, Growth, Demand And Report 2024-2032

The latest report by IMARC Group, titled “Video Wall Market Report by Product (LCD Display System, LED Display System, LPD Display System, and Others), Service (Housing, Installation, Content Management), Deployment Type (Touch Based, Touch Less, Multi Touch, and Others), Technology (Rear Projection Display, Narrow Bezel Display), Vertical (Retail, IT and Telecommunication, Government and Defense, Media and Entertainment, and Others), and Region 2024-2032“, The global video wall market size reached US$ 17.9 Billion in 2023.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ach US$ 94.0 Billion by 2032,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 19.6% during 2024-2032. 

Factors Driving the Growth of the Video Wall Industry

Advancements in Display Technology:
The growth of the video wall industry is largely driven by continuous improvements in display technology. Innovations like OLED, Micro LED, and advanced LCD panels have significantly boosted the visual quality, resolution, and durability of video walls. OLED displays offer exceptional color accuracy, contrast, and flexibility, making them ideal for premium installations. Micro LED technology delivers even brighter displays, higher energy efficiency, and seamless, bezel-free designs. These technological advancements not only enhance the visual impact and performance of video walls but also lower operational and maintenance costs, encouraging wider adoption across industries.

Rising Demand for Immersive Experiences:
The growing need for immersive and engaging experiences is a major driver for the video wall industry. Sectors such as retail, entertainment, and corporate environments are increasingly using video walls to create visually compelling displays. In retail, they serve as dynamic digital signage and interactive displays to enhance customer engagement and boost sales. Entertainment venues use video walls to create captivating backdrops for performances and events, while corporate settings rely on them for collaborative meetings, data visualization, and control room operations. The trend toward experiential marketing and interactive content is further fueling investment in video walls as a powerful tool to grab attention and communicate effectively.

Growth of Smart Cities and Digital Infrastructure:
The development of smart cities and expansion of digital infrastructure are also key factors driving the video wall market. As cities adopt digital technologies for traffic control, public safety, and information sharing, the demand for large, high-resolution displays is increasing. Video walls are commonly used in public spaces like transportation hubs, government buildings, and control centers to provide real-time information and improve public engagement. Their integration into smart city projects aligns with broader trends in digital transformation and urban innovation, further accelerating growth and investment in the video wall industry.
